Good jacket that needs tweaking.
I'm 6'3" and 115KG and the XL is still a bit of a tent on me! But, if anything I'd like the front to be an inch or two longer. After wearing the jacket inside for 10 minutes I did feel a bit like a boil in the bag fish; there was quite a lot of humidity inside the jacket.There are side vents in each side of the jacket with zips, these is like to see relocated to under the armpit areas because they really don't help much with ventilation being so low down.This jacket doesn't come with a hood, something I was aware of when buying. However, this jacket needs a hood! It's fine to say that when you're cycling you'll be wearing a helmet but what do you do when you stop and is chucking it down? Why not have a detachable hood or something really thin that folds away, it wouldn't add much weight but it would make it infinitely more useful.Speaking of being useful, why not have two side pockets? This I find by far the most annoying part of this jacket's design. They can also act as extra vents. People always have something they need to store and not having side pockets is just pointless. The top pocket for a phone or card is useful.The material is pretty tough and I can report that it's very waterproof and windproof. The extra large jacket weighs 804g. The reflective material is incredibly effective in even the weakest of light.Overall, as with all Mountain Warehouse kit, this is a high quality garment that performs really well. With just a few tweaks it could perfect.

Not breathable
They've cheaped out by not having the mesh cover the length of the arms and the combined with a distinct lack of breathability it leads to humidity getting trapped.I've just come back to the jacket 4 hours after riding and there is actually full beads of moisture in the forearms from where the heat has been caught. I've never had any type of jacket do this before.Very disappointing as in all other respects its a nice jacket and very visable when riding.

Great value and well up to the job.
Fantastic lightweight cycling jacket from Mountain Warehouse.Keeps you pretty dry in the rain, and has side breathing vents that can be open or closed with a zip.3 spacious pockets on the front allow plenty of room for your phone and keys, with an additional zipped large pocket on the rear that can accommodate a pair of waterproof trousers which is very handy.All in all, a great product with a great price that is more than adequate for my needs.Highly recommended.
